Leah Beardslee

Communications Coordinator at Office of the Governor- Illinois

Leah Beardslee is currently the Communications Coordinator at the Office of the Governor of Illinois, specifically serving under Governor JB Pritzker. Her role includes strategic communications and public relations efforts for the state government. Prior to this position, Beardslee worked as a Deputy Press Secretary, where she contributed to various campaigns and initiatives, including public health awareness campaigns related to COVID-19 vaccination efforts in Illinois.1

Beardslee has a strong background in communications, having developed skills through nearly six years of experience in nonpartisan roles on Capitol Hill. She is known for her ability to create and execute strategic communications that inspire change.2 Her educational background includes studies at Johns Hopkins University, which further supports her expertise in this field.2
